The first Open-Source AI Summit was held in Abu Dhabi by the Technology Innovation Institute (TII). It was an event where experts from around the world came together to talk about the future of open-source AI.

The summit took place at The St. Regis Saadiyat Island Resort in Abu Dhabi. There were big companies like Meta, Google DeepMind, Oxford University, and Tsinghua University attending. Local organizations like Inception Institute and TII were also there. TII is known for creating the Falcon series of AI models.
At the summit, the experts discussed important topics like making AI safe for everyone, making sure it can be used by people everywhere, and how countries can work together. The event was important because it came after the Open-Source Initiative shared its definition of open-source AI.
Dr. Najwa Aaraj, the CEO of TII, said, "This summit was an important step toward making sure AI is helpful and safe for everyone. We brought the best minds together to work on this."
Dr. Hakim Hacid, a researcher at TII, said, "At TII, we focus on creating AI systems that are clear and strong. This summit gave us a chance to talk with experts about how to make AI safe and work for everyone."
TII was one of the first to release the Falcon 40B AI model in May 2023. The Falcon models are some of the best open-source AI systems and are ranked high on HuggingFace, a popular website that tracks AI models.
This summit helped experts come up with ways to make sure AI is safe and works for everyone. It allowed people to share ideas and made sure AI can benefit everyone around the world.
